  • VMware VSAN vs Nutanix

    Hi all

    I like to discuss the pros and cons of both solutions

    Pros - VSAN is integrated into the vmkernel, Nutanix ia a virtual machine.

    Cons - Nutanix is more flexible, interact with the other hipervisors (XEN and Hyper-V)

    Pros - vSAN is compatible with the most expensive equipment and only nutanix counterpart hardware.

    more questions for this dircussion?

    Pros - VSAN is integrated into the vmkernel, Nutanix ia a virtual machine.

    In my opinion, there are very few benefits to be integrated into the vmkernel, is one of the benefits of running in a virtual machine that is not depends on the version of the hypervisor.

    For example, you can run the latest version of Nutanix with vSphere 5.5, is not possible with VSANS since its related to the version of the hypervisor.

    Cons - Nutanix is more flexible, interact with the other hipervisors (XEN and Hyper-V)

    XEN is not taken in charge but AVS (a version of KVM), Hyper-V and all supported versions of vSphere. (Possibly other hypervisors in the future)

    Pros - vSAN is compatible with the most expensive equipment and only nutanix counterpart hardware.

    Nutanix is available on multiple hardware platforms such as Supermicro, Dell and Lenovo.

    WARNING: Used Nutanix but try to remain objective.

    Linjo

  • Question of T61p

    Hello

    My computer has a long and two short beeps.  This is not the first time that has happened.  In April, wellllll out of warranty, Lenovo has replaced my GPU and everything was fine and dandy.  All my friends were supprised with the customer service provided by Lenovo in these dark times.  On my advice, one of my best friends even bought a beautiful W520 not too long ago.  Earlier this month, my computer went to sleep and never woke up with the same problem.  I called Lenovo and told that the repair is under warranty for 90 days.  The customer service agent was so rough.  So, my computer died a month too late.  I was wondering why the Lenovo would not always respect their computers and replace it because it's a known issue, I already got repaired.  I was a full supporter Thinkpad flight with my help, I had my parents and brother buy Lenovo.  It's downhill from my computer died with the purchase of a new Thinkpad W520.  I'm in College majoring in architecture and really really really need a computer, so once ordered I am expecting to receive a.  He has been hanging out in NC for about a week.  It became frustrating to deal with Lenovo and I feel like it would have been better to go with an another computer company.  I just my T61p set so I can have 2 and Lenovo Thinkpads opperable what point people of show is.

    Thank you

    Replace the GPU is not possible (without expensive equipment), it is integrated with the system board. Replacing the motherboard is not difficult for a trained technician, or enthousiest, but this isn't replaing a keyboard or a hard drive, you need to remove a large number of tiny parts and fittings of the cables, as well as your processor. A careless handling can damage these devices of discharge of static electricity, and errors are not well tolorated by sensivive microelectronics, but defintely is a feasible task for someone willing to learn and accept the risks involved.

    However, finding a change of motherboard that is profitable is the problem. Your best bet would be to seek a donor used machine. If you want without the faulty gpu, you should look for a date code from 08/08 (August 2008) or newer. The previous codes have an extra chance of bad GPU, to reach 100%, if you come back enough months (some of this data is a bit "fuzzy" because I'm always looking for clarification on certain issues).

    The best candidate for a donor would be one with a processor Penryn T8xx/T9xx of the models. They require a newer Board so there's an ot less with GPU defective.

    You also have the option to get a faulty Council 'working '. Many are still in service, and it will remain so for years to come. A laptop that starts at the bios and has a screen broken for $30-50 would be a good candidate regardless of GPU, you want to get more experience and learning then you could buy for that price anywhere and "can" end up with a good system usable.

    PS. During the last two weeks, I bought on the work unit complete with the date code 08/09 for 180usd in almost perfect condition and the other with the 08/08 which has 4 GB, 500 GB hard drive and the processor T9300 under 300usd, both are complete with good gpu systems, and the two combined are less expensive then a new motherboard. These offers can still be found if you know what to look for and exactly what questions to ask.

    Not exactly. The video chip is on what is called ball grid array. As the chip is overheating and cools down, the connections to the motherboard (i.e. Bay) become brittle and break off, so that there is no full contact with the circuit of the motherboard. It can be "reorganized" so that it becomes liquid and all connection again by applying heat evenly. The trick is to do it at the right temperature and to monitor the process. It can be done by the motherboard in the oven just cooking, but it is not reliable. It works best when you have real expensive equipment, but which does not improve with real expensive equipment?

    Of course, it all depends on the budget available, but if I upgrade now an i7-930, these would be my main ingredients:

    • CPU: i7-5930 K or i7-5960 X. Not the i7 - 5820K as suggested above because of the limitation of only 28 PCIe lanes, which closes off the coast of expansion capability.
    • Mobo: Asus X99E-WS
    • Memory: GSkill Ripjaws 4 F4-2666, 32 or 64 GB
    • Disc of BONE: Samsung SM951 SSD, 256 GB m2
    • Extra PCIe card: card PCIe M2 Addonics ADM2X4 for
    • Media / disk cache: Samsung SM951 SSD, 512 GB m2

    and continue to use the GTX970 and the current HDD on SATA 6 G ports. I would certainly like to overclock the CPU at about 4.5 GHz.

    If you have still a few available budget, I would add that some Samsung 850 Pro 1 TB SSD on SATA 6 G ports for media and projects and delegate 1 TB for backup HARD drive.

    That way you can later add another Addonics card when the Samsung SM951 NVMe m2 readers reach 1 TB of capacity and possibly a second GTX without running out of lane PCIe 970. If you were to go in the direction of 'cheap' with the i7 - 5820K, you would have used 16 (video) + 4 (m2), 4 (ADM2X4) = available 28 24 lanes PCIe, leaving no room for a raid controller or a second video card.

    An i7 - 4790K is not an option, because it's only a 4-core, which is only marginally faster than the i7 - 930 (certainly not twice as fast, as claimed in the previous post), he is severely handicapped by only 16 available PCIe lanes used by the video card has no crack m2 on the mobo and you can reuse only 16 GB of your existing RAM except if you have sticks of 3 x 8 GB, in which case you would need one extra to get to 32 GB identical bar. 24 GB is not an option on a mobo 11xx due to the memory controller.
